Vendor Qualifications and Insurance
Local gear, loyal neighbours, bigger nights. When you’re sorting catering rentals near me, the best choices carry a quiet confidence—that comes from years of service and a map of local venues. In my years on the road, gear that knows the room speaks the language of your space, cutting setup time and avoiding drama. Choosing local equipment means dependable ovens, well‑ventilated coolers, and transport that slides in like it belongs there, ready to sing once the lights come up.
Vendor qualifications and insurance prove the difference between a good night and a great one. Look for clear licensing, public liability insurance, and documented maintenance records. A responsive delivery team and on‑site technician support help the evening stay on track, even when the unexpected taps its foot on the door. To keep things transparent, ask for a written warranty and terms that travel with the gear:
- Licensing and compliance
- Public liability insurance
- Maintenance history and on-site support

Local Rental Companies vs Marketplace Platforms
Nothing sabotages an event faster than a gear shortfall, and in South Africa’s dynamic market, the search for catering gear begins long before the first guest arrives. The choice between local rental companies and marketplace platforms can set your event’s tempo and fate. That choice sets your event’s tempo!
Local rental companies offer hands-on service, letting you tour options, test equipment, and tailor bundles to fit a kitchen flow.
- On-site demonstrations and pre-event checks
- Flexible pickup and delivery windows
- Closer relationships with local staff for quick problem-solving
Marketplace platforms pool reviews, price comparisons, and nationwide fleets into one portal, helping you gauge value at a glance. For locals typing ‘catering rentals near me,’ the platform route translates search intent into broad options and instant quotes.
Which path wins often hinges on event size, location, and how much you value hands-on support versus speed and breadth.
